| * Export PDF Book with Paged.js | |
| * | |
| * Generates a professional book-quality PDF using Playwright + Paged.js polyfill. | |
| * Paged.js implements W3C CSS Paged Media specs that browsers don't support natively: | |
| * - @page :left / :right (alternating margins for binding) | |
| * - Running headers via string-set | |
| * - Footnotes via float: footnote | |
| * - Named pages (@page chapter) | |
| * - target-counter() for ToC page numbers | |
| * - bookmark-level for PDF outline | |
| * | |
| * Usage: | |
| * npm run export:pdf:book | |
| * npm run export:pdf:book -- --theme=light --format=A4 | |
| * | |
| * Options: | |
| * --theme=light|dark Color theme (default: light) | |
| * --format=A4|Letter Page format (default: A4) | |
| * --filename=xxx Output filename (default: <title>-book) | |
| * --wait=full Wait strategy (default: full) | |
| * --debug Keep browser open for inspection | |
| */ | |
